Tequila 61 offers upscale, welcoming Latin-inspired dining in downtown Anchorage. Guests praise the elegant decor, a Latin vibe with music, and attentive service (notably by Ana A). The menu features oysters, a 14 oz Gaucho steak, halibut, and tacos, plus memorable cocktails and smoked drinks, making it a premier spot for seafood and Mexican fare.

Awesome venue, food and drinks. Great conversation at the Bar! I have eaten Raw Oysters in Florida most of my life, tried raw Oysters in Maine the summer of 2023 and now Alaska in January of 2026! I will have to say the Oysters in Alaska and Maine have the taste and texture the Florida Oysters had 25 years ago. Excellent Oysters come out of these cold waters! And the Tequila was taste too!😁

From the moment we walked into Tequila 61, the ambiance set the tone for a relaxing dinner. The decor appear to be very well thought out and the flower bouquets are a very nice touch. The Latin music created a laid back vibe that made us feel instantly at home (we are visiting from Orlando). After an afternoon of hiking the Matanuska Glacier, our server Ana A started us with the berry soda and Popcorn Shrimp which was very flavorful. For our main entree, Ana A recommended the 14 oz Gaucho steak which was absolutely just what I needed. We also tried the Halibut and the Duck Confit Tacos as well as the Carne Asada Tacos. The Duck Confit was absolutely delicious!!!!! And for dessert, we wrapped things up with the Horchata Cornbread which was unexpectedly better than I thought it would be. Overall, I loved Tequila 61. If I get the chance to go again beforethe end of my trip, I'm going to try the Salmon.
